Kreidler speaks to consumers in Shoreline about Medicare

Image
Attendees to a Medicare birthday event on Saturday morning got to hear Insurance Commissioner Kreidler talk about why Medicare is important and what SHIBA does for Washington consumers.  Commissioner Kreidler and Judy Ellis, SHIBA volunteer with Sound Generations in Shoreline  SHIBA stands for Statewide Health Insurance Benefits Advisors . It’s a statewide network of nearly 400 highly trained volunteers who have been helping seniors and others understand their health insurance options for more than 35 years in Washington state. Washington was the first state in the nation to establish a SHIBA program, before the federal government offered assistance in reaching out the consumers who are or are about to be enrolled in Medicare. Medicare provides health coverage for nearly 45 million Americans who are age 65 and older, and for 7 million younger adults with permanent disabilities.
